Dusty winds to continue as UAE sees a drop in temperatures this week

Gusts reaching 40 km/h will trigger dusty conditions at intervals.

The UAE is expected to see generally fair weather today, along with a slight drop in temperatures, especially in northern regions, according to the National Centre of Meteorology (NCM).

Light to moderate south-westerly to north-westerly winds are forecast to freshen at times, reaching speeds of up to 40 km/h. These conditions may lead to blowing dust across parts of the country.

Seas will be slight to moderate in the Arabian Gulf, becoming rough at times, while the Oman Sea is expected to remain slight.

Maximum temperatures are expected to range between 42–47°C in inland areas, 36–42°C along the coast and islands, and 32–38°C in mountainous regions.

The weather is likely to remain generally fair through Friday, with occasional partly cloudy skies over eastern areas on Wednesday. Fresh winds will continue to cause blowing dust and sand at times, with speeds of 10–25 km/h, occasionally reaching up to 40 km/h.

On Saturday, low cloud cover is expected over islands and northern regions, while humidity levels are set to rise overnight and into Sunday morning in some coastal areas. Sea conditions will vary, with the Arabian Gulf becoming rough at times in western waters, while the Oman Sea is expected to remain slight.
